Job Overview: A law firm seeks a Corporate Real Estate Associate Attorney for its New York City office. The ideal candidate should understand complex real estate transactions, including joint ventures, development projects, acquisitions, dispositions, real estate M&A, and financings. Excellent drafting, analytical, and organizational skills are essential, along with a keen understanding and appreciation of the business of real estate investing.

Duties:

  • Conduct legal research and analysis related to corporate real estate matters.
  • Draft and negotiate agreements, including purchase and sale agreements, leases, financing documents, and joint venture agreements.
  • Provide legal advice and guidance to clients on various real estate transactions.
  • Collaborate with partners and senior associates on complex real estate projects.
  • Assist in due diligence investigations and risk assessments for real estate transactions.
  • Attend meetings, negotiations, and closings as required.

Requirements:

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admitted to practice law in the state of New York.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in corporate real estate transactions.
  • Experience with joint ventures, development projects, acquisitions, dispositions, real estate M&A, and financings.
  • Strong drafting, analytical,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to work efficiently under pressure and manage multiple priorities.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Detail-oriented with a commitment to accuracy and thoroughness.
